for 1st
let f(x)=x^(1/x)
find its extreme.
you will find that it is maximum at x=e
hence
e^(1/e)>pi^(1/pi)
raise both sides to the power e*pi and you will get your answer.

Catalogs Discussion Forums -> Algebra -> Prove yourself ! PROBLEM CHALLENGE IN ALGEBRA!!!!!!!!!! -> Go to message
This Post 7 points    (Olaaa!! Perrrfect answer.   in 2 votes )   [?]
3 replies   
THE ANSWER IS 29.


Let n be a number of the form6x+10y+15z
n+1=6(x+1)+10(y-2)+15(z+1)
n+2=6(x+2)+10(y-1)+15(z+0)
n+3=6(x-2)+10(y-0)+15(z+1)
n+4=6(x+4)+10(y-2)+15(z+0)
n+5=6(x+0)+10(y-1)+15(z+1)
n+6=6(x+1)+10(y-0)+15(z+0)
n+7=(n+6)+1
and so. on

hence, if x-2,y-2 are non-negative, we can express any number greater than it in the given form.
So the minimum number beyond which every number is in the given form is 32.

To find the greatest number which is not expressible in the given form, we start backwards from 31 and we find that the answer is 29
{31=6+10+15, 30=15+15}
